Jon Hunter b34e2f9554 video: tegra: nvmap: Fix f_count for Linux v6.13
In Linux v6.13, 'f_count' has been replaced by 'f_ref' in the 'file'
structure. Use conftest to detect if 'f_ref' is present and update the
NVMAP driver accordingly.

Please note that in most cases we can simply use the 'file_count' macro
for getting the count and this has been supported since Linux v2.6.
